Methods and devices are provided for reducing the concentration of low molecular weight compounds in a biological composition containing cells while substantially maintaining a desired biological activity of the biological composition. The device comprises highly porous adsorbent particles, and the adsorbent particles are immobilized by an inert matrix.

The invention relates to a treatment compartment (1) for treating histological samples with treating agents (2, 2null, 2null). Said treatment compartment (1) comprises a housing (3) with an inlet and outlet (4, 4null) for the treating agents (2, 2null, 2null), a rotatable retaining device (5) which receives the samples and a closable access opening (6) on the front (7). The aim of the invention is to improve a treatment compartment (1) of the above kind in such a way that it has a compact design and is easily accessible without the risk of the treating agents (2, 2null, 2null) emerging. According to the invention, the housing (3) is designed and mounted in such a manner and at least the lower zone of the front (7) is provided with such a rim (8) that a liquid level (9) of the treating agents (2, 2null, 2null) can be formed even when the access opening (6) is open, and that the sample is held in the retaining device (5) in such a way that it can be moved, when the retaining device rotates, through the treating agents (2, 2null, 2null) forming the liquid level (9).

Chemical and biological reactors, including microreactors, are provided. Exemplary reactors include a plurality of reactors operable in parallel, where each reactor has a small volume and, together, the reactors produce a large volume of product. Reaction systems can include mixing chambers, heating/dispersion units, reaction chambers, and separation units. Components of the reactors can be readily formed from a variety of materials. For example, they can be etched from silicon. Components are connectable to and separable from each other to form a variety of types of reactors, and the reactors can be attachable to and separable from each other to add significant flexibility in parallel and/or series reactor operation.

A biochemical vessel has a plurality of sample holding cells juxtaposed one next to another. Each cell has a light transparent bottom. Each sample holding cell includes, in its inner side, a light reflecting face which extends radially away from the axis of the cell as the reflecting face extends downwards.

A micro-fluidic device having a cavity containing a solid support (e.g., a plurality of particles) and a biomolecule immobilized on a surface of the solid support is provided. The micro-fluidic device can be used to monitor interactions between a biomolecule in a sample and the biomolecule immobilized on the solid support. For example, the micro-fluidic device can be used to monitor protein self-interactions wherein the protein in the sample is the same protein as that immobilized on the surface of the solid support. A method of making the micro-fluidic device is also described. The micro-fluidic device can be used for chromatographic applications where sample consumption is crucial.

A sensor utilizing a non-leachable or diffusible redox mediator is described. The sensor includes a sample chamber to hold a sample in electrolytic contact with a working electrode, and in at least some instances, the sensor also contains a non-leachable or a diffusible second electron transfer agent. The sensor and/or the methods used produce a sensor signal in response to the analyte that can be distinguished from a background signal caused by the mediator. The invention can be used to determine the concentration of a biomolecule, such as glucose or lactate, in a biological fluid, such as blood or serum, using techniques such as coulometry, amperometry, and potentiometry. An enzyme capable of catalyzing the electrooxidation or electroreduction of the biomolecule is typically provided as a second electron transfer agent.

A non-disruptive three-dimensional culture system allows cell growth and proliferation in three dimensions, permitting cell splitting without subjecting cells to disruptive conditions that affect cell structure and functions. An extracellular matrix provides a good environment for culturing or co-culturing anchorage-dependent cells. The cells cultured this manner can be readily used in such applications as cell transplantation, tissue engineering seeding of cells on scaffolds, and other applications that require immediate availability of functioning cells.

A method and an apparatus is provided for aeration of organic material, wherein the organic material undergoes an aerobic composting process, such that air is caused to evenly penetrate the organic material. The organic material is first sealed in a vessel. Air is then delivered to the contents of the vessel such that an air pressure of from about 1 to about 1000 kPa above atmospheric pressure is maintained in the vessel. A pressure differential initially forms and is then allowed to equilibrate over a period of time, in which time air flows from areas of high pressure to areas of low pressure in the organic material thus ensuring that aeration is evenly distributed throughout the organic material.

Apparatus suitable for use in the treatment of waste and/or organic materials which includes a main body having a treatment chamber therein having a base which when the apparatus is in a harvesting mode is arranged with a space there below. The base includes a plurality of generally parallel spaced apart support elements, the support elements being spaced apart at a distance sufficient to support the material within the chamber during the treatment process and enable extraction of the treated material through the spaces between the support elements during a harvesting process. There is also disclosed a harvesting device comprising a plurality of extraction elements which are adapted to project through the spaces between the support elements to dislodge and extract the treated material through the base. The apparatus and harvesting device is particularly useful for removing worm casting in vermiculture.
